📈 Current Stock Situation and Historical Context

As of September 1, 2025, here’s the crucial update: Logan Ridge Finance Corporation (LRFC) no longer trades independently. The stock was delisted on July 15, 2025, following its merger with Portman Ridge Finance Corporation. The final recorded price was $19.08, but this represents historical data rather than a current trading opportunity.

The Merger That Changed Everything

Mark July 15, 2025, as the transformational date. That’s when LRFC completed its merger with Portman Ridge, creating a combined entity with over $600 million in assets. LRFC shareholders received approximately 1.5 shares of Portman Ridge (PTMN) common stock for each LRFC share they held, plus special cash distributions totaling $0.85 per share.

Earnings Pattern Analysis: What History Teaches Us

Looking back at LRFC’s earnings history reveals fascinating patterns. The company had a mixed track record of beating analyst expectations – out of 48 earnings periods, they exceeded forecasts only 16 times while missing 26 times.

The most dramatic reaction occurred after Q4 2024 results (March 13, 2025) when LRFC smashed expectations with EPS of $0.56 versus $0.37 estimates – a 51.35% beat! Surprisingly, the stock dropped 4.96% that day and 8.46% over five days. This counterintuitive reaction shows that even strong fundamentals don’t guarantee positive price movement during corporate uncertainty periods.

🌍 Logan Ridge’s Legacy and Market Position

Logan Ridge Finance Corporation specialized in providing senior subordinated debt, unitranche, and first-lien/second-lien loans to middle-market companies across sectors including aerospace, defense, healthcare, and industrial services. The company maintained a consistent dividend policy with yields around 7.55% before the merger.

Interesting Fact from 2025: The merger approval process showed remarkable shareholder unity – an impressive 88% of Portman Ridge shareholders voted in favor of combining with Logan Ridge, demonstrating strong confidence in the strategic rationale behind creating a larger, more diversified lending platform.
